Solution for 16x^2+9x^2=4900 equation:



16x^2+9x^2=4900
We move all terms to the left:
16x^2+9x^2-(4900)=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
25x^2-4900=0
a = 25; b = 0; c = -4900;
Δ = b2-4ac
Δ = 02-4·25·(-4900)
Δ = 490000
The delta value is higher than zero, so the equation has two solutions
We use following formulas to calculate our solutions:
$x_{1}=\frac{-b-\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}$
$x_{2}=\frac{-b+\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}$

$\sqrt{\Delta}=\sqrt{490000}=700$
$x_{1}=\frac{-b-\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}=\frac{-(0)-700}{2*25}=\frac{-700}{50} =-14 $
$x_{2}=\frac{-b+\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}=\frac{-(0)+700}{2*25}=\frac{700}{50} =14 $
